Official abstract text for this publication.
According to an aspect of the present invention, there is provided a sheet processing device including a first teeth portion, a second teeth portion that clamps and binds a sheet bundle with the first teeth portion, a first support portion supporting the first teeth portion, a shaft, and a second support portion supporting the second teeth portion. The second support portion includes first and second arm members integrally supported to be capable of swinging around the shaft between a binding position in which the second teeth portion clamps and binds the sheet bundle with the first teeth portion and a standby position in which the second teeth portion is apart from the first teeth portion. The second arm member is provided over the first arm member so as to cover a part of the first arm member.

What is claimed is: 1. A sheet processing device comprising: a first teeth portion; a second teeth portion configured to clamp and bind a sheet bundle with the first teeth portion; a first support portion configured to support the first teeth portion; a shaft; and a second support portion configured to support the second teeth portion and being swingably supported around the shaft between a binding position in which the second teeth portion clamps and binds the sheet bundle with the first teeth portion and a standby position in which the second teeth portion is apart from the first teeth portion, the second support portion including: a first arm member including a first portion and a pair of first side portions provided on both ends of the first portion, each of the pair of first side portions extending perpendicular to the first portion and defining a first through-hole in which the shaft is inserted; and a second arm member including a second portion and a pair of second side portions provided on both ends of the second portion, each of the pair of second side portions extending perpendicular to the second portion and defining a second through-hole in which the shaft is inserted, the second arm member being fixed to the first arm member. 2. The sheet processing device according to claim 1 , wherein the second support portion receives a load applied to the second teeth portion dispersedly by the first and second arm members in a state where the second support portion is positioned in the binding position. 3. The sheet processing device according to claim 2 , wherein the second arm member regulates deflection of the first arm member in a state where the second support portion is positioned in the binding position. 4. The sheet processing device according to claim 3 , wherein the second teeth portion is provided on the first arm member, and wherein the second arm member is disposed apart from the second teeth portion in a state where the second support portion is positioned in the standby position, and contacts with the second teeth portion by the first arm member deflecting in a direction separated from the first teeth portion in a state where the second support portion is positioned in the binding position. 5. The sheet processing device according to claim 1 , wherein the first and second arm members are plate members and a plate thickness of the first arm member is less than a plate thickness of the second arm member. 6. The sheet processing device according to claim 1 , wherein the first arm member is a plate member of a U-shaped cross section and bent between the first portion and the first side portions, and wherein the second arm member is a plate member of a U-shaped cross section and bent between the second portion and the second side portions. 7. The sheet processing device according to claim 6 , wherein the second teeth portion is provided on the first arm member and a plate thickness of the first arm member is thinner than a plate thickness of the second arm member. 8. The sheet processing device according to claim 6 , wherein the first arm member includes first bending portions formed in a circular arc shape between the first portion and each of the first side portions, and wherein a distance between a surface, on a side opposite to a surface facing the second portion, of the first portion and each first through-hole is set to a sum of twice the plate thickness of the first arm member and a radius of an inner surface of one of the first bending portions. 9. The sheet processing device according to claim 8 , wherein a radius of the inner side surface of one of the first bending portions is set to a half of the plate thickness of the first arm member. 10. The sheet processing device according to claim 6 , wherein the second arm member includes second bending portions formed in a circular arc shape between the second portion and each of the second side portions, and wherein a distance between a surface, on a side opposite to a surface facing the first portion, of the second portion and each second through-hole is set to be greater than a sum of twice the plate thickness of the second arm member and a radius of an inner surface of one of the second bending portions, and less than three times the plate thickness of the second arm member. 11. The sheet processing device according to claim 10 , wherein the radius of the inner side surface of one of the second bending portions is set to a half of the plate thickness of the second arm member. 12. The sheet processing device according to claim 1 , wherein the first support portion is a plate member of which an external dimension is greater than that of the second arm member, and wherein a plate thickness of the first support portion is thicker than a plate thickness of the second arm member. 13. The sheet processing device according to claim 1 , further comprising: a cam that presses an end of the second support portion and swings the second support portion around the shaft. 14. The sheet processing device according to claim 13 , wherein the second support portion includes a fixing portion that is disposed between the shaft and the end of the second support portion, and connects the first arm member and the second arm member. 15. The sheet processing device according to claim 13 , wherein the second teeth portion is disposed on an end of the first arm member, positioned opposite to the end of the second support portion across the shaft. 16. An image forming apparatus comprising: an image forming portion that forms an image on a sheet; and the sheet processing device according to claim 1 that binds the sheet on which the image is formed by the image forming portion. 17. The sheet processing device according to claim 1 , wherein the second teeth portion is disposed so as to overlap with the pair of first side portions of the first arm member and the pair of second side portions of the second arm member in an axial direction of the shaft. 18. The sheet processing device according to claim 17 , wherein the second teeth portion comprises a block portion disposed between the pair of first side portions of the first arm member, an extension portion, and a teeth part provided on the extension portion and configured to clamp and bind the sheet bundle, and wherein the extension portion is integrally provided on the block portion, extends in the axial direction of the shaft, and is configured to contact the first and second arm members. 19.
